  • The South African Department of Water and Environmental Affairs is conducting an Institutional Reform and Realignment process to review the number and framework of catchment management agencies (CMAs). Challenges identified in the Inkomati and Breede-Overberg agencies include insufficient technical capacity and unclear accountability. No timeline exists for full operationality of all CMAs, pending the completion of the reform process in approximately 12 months. Revenue collection remains with the Department rather than the CMAs.
